B2B event marketing refers to the process of promoting and marketing products or services to other businesses through face-to-face events, such as conferences, trade shows, seminars, and webinars. It is a strategic marketing approach that aims to create meaningful experiences and interactions between companies and their target audience. Understanding the Basics of B2B Event Marketing

Definition of B2B Event Marketing

B2B event marketing can be defined as a marketing strategy that focuses on creating and executing events specifically tailored to engage and influence other businesses. These events provide opportunities for companies to showcase their products or services, network with industry professionals, generate leads, and build brand awareness.

When it comes to B2B event marketing, the possibilities are endless. From trade shows and conferences to seminars and webinars, businesses have a wide range of event formats to choose from. Each format offers unique advantages and can be customized to suit the specific goals and objectives of the company.

One of the key elements of B2B event marketing is the ability to create an immersive and interactive experience for attendees. This can be achieved through various means, such as engaging keynote speakers, hands-on workshops, product demonstrations, and networking opportunities.

Furthermore, B2B event marketing goes beyond just the event itself. It encompasses the entire process, from pre-event promotion to post-event follow-up. Effective promotion strategies, such as targeted email campaigns, social media advertising, and content marketing, are crucial in driving attendance and maximizing the impact of the event.

The Importance of B2B Event Marketing

B2B event marketing plays a vital role in the overall marketing mix of businesses for several reasons. Firstly, it allows companies to directly engage with their target audience, facilitating meaningful interactions that can lead to valuable business relationships.

By attending industry-specific events, businesses have the opportunity to connect with like-minded professionals who share similar interests and challenges. This creates a conducive environment for networking, knowledge sharing, and collaboration.

In addition, events provide a platform for companies to demonstrate their expertise, showcase their offerings, and differentiate themselves from competitors. Through thought leadership presentations, panel discussions, and case studies, businesses can position themselves as industry leaders and gain credibility among their target audience.

Furthermore, B2B event marketing allows businesses to gather valuable market insights, generate leads, and nurture existing relationships. By interacting with attendees, companies can gain a deeper understanding of market trends, customer preferences, and industry pain points. This information can then be used to refine marketing strategies, develop new products or services, and improve overall business performance.

Moreover, events provide an ideal opportunity for lead generation. By capturing attendee information through registration forms or lead-capture technologies, businesses can build a database of qualified leads for future marketing campaigns. These leads can be nurtured through personalized follow-up communications, such as email newsletters, webinars, or one-on-one meetings.

The Evolution of B2B Event Marketing

B2B event marketing has evolved significantly over the years. Previously, events primarily focused on in-person interactions, such as trade shows and conferences. These events provided a platform for businesses to showcase their products and services, network with industry professionals, and generate leads. However, with the advent of digital technology, the landscape of event marketing has transformed.

Virtual events, webinars, and hybrid events (a combination of in-person and virtual components) have become increasingly popular in recent years. These new formats have opened up a world of possibilities for businesses, providing them with more flexibility and reach. Virtual events, in particular, have gained traction due to their ability to connect participants from all over the world, eliminating the need for travel and accommodation expenses.

A Brief History of B2B Event Marketing

Let’s take a closer look at the history of B2B event marketing. It all started with the traditional trade shows and conferences that have been a staple of the business world for decades. These events were held in physical venues, where companies would set up booths and engage with attendees face-to-face. They served as a platform for showcasing new products, conducting live demonstrations, and fostering business relationships.

As technology advanced, the concept of webinars emerged. Webinars allowed businesses to host educational and informative sessions online, reaching a wider audience without the constraints of physical location. This format proved to be highly effective in generating leads and establishing thought leadership within industries.

Fast forward to the present day, and we have witnessed the rise of virtual events. These events take the concept of webinars to a whole new level, offering a fully immersive experience for participants. Through virtual platforms, businesses can create interactive environments where attendees can explore virtual exhibitor booths, attend live presentations, and network with other professionals.

The Impact of Digital Transformation on B2B Event Marketing

Digital transformation has revolutionized the way B2B event marketing is conducted. With the integration of digital technologies, businesses now can reach a global audience with ease. Virtual events, in particular, have become a game-changer for event organizers, as they eliminate geographical barriers and allow for participation from anywhere in the world.

In addition to global reach, digital technologies have also significantly reduced costs associated with event marketing. With virtual events, businesses no longer need to spend on venue rentals, travel expenses, and physical booth setups. These cost savings can be redirected towards enhancing the overall event experience, investing in cutting-edge technology, or even offering more value to attendees through giveaways or exclusive content.

Furthermore, digital technologies provide opportunities for interactive experiences, enhancing the overall event experience for participants. Features such as live polls, Q&A sessions, and networking opportunities can be seamlessly integrated into virtual event platforms, fostering engagement and facilitating meaningful connections. Attendees can actively participate in discussions, share their insights, and connect with industry peers, creating a sense of community even in a virtual setting.

Critical Components of a Successful B2B Event Marketing Strategy

Identifying Your Target Audience

Before planning any event, it is crucial to identify and understand your target audience. This involves conducting market research to gather insights into their preferences, challenges, and expectations. By understanding your audience, you can tailor your event content, format, and promotional activities to resonate with their needs, ultimately increasing engagement and generating quality leads.

Setting Clear Goals and Objectives

Setting clear goals and objectives is essential for any B2B event marketing strategy. Whether it is to generate leads, increase brand awareness, or educate attendees, having well-defined objectives will guide your event planning process and ensure that all activities align with your desired outcomes.

Choosing the Right Event Format

Selecting the appropriate event format is crucial for the success of your B2B event marketing efforts. Depending on your goals, audience preferences, and budget, you can opt for in-person events, virtual events, webinars, or hybrid events. Each format has its advantages and limitations, so be sure to consider factors such as geographical reach, cost-effectiveness, and audience engagement when making a decision.

The Role of Technology in B2B Event Marketing

Virtual and Hybrid Events

Virtual and hybrid events have become increasingly popular due to their flexibility and accessibility. By leveraging platforms such as webinars, video conferences, and virtual event platforms, businesses can reach a global audience, eliminate geographical barriers, and reduce costs associated with physical events. These formats also allow for interactive features like live chats, networking lounges, and virtual booths, enhancing attendee engagement.

Event Management Software and Tools

In today’s digital age, event management software, and tools play a crucial role in streamlining and automating various event-related tasks. From event registration and ticketing to attendee tracking and post-event surveys, these tools simplify the event management process, improve operational efficiency, and provide valuable data for analysis.

Leveraging Social Media for Event Promotion

Social media platforms have become powerful tools for event promotion and engagement. By leveraging platforms like LinkedIn, Twitter, and Facebook, businesses can create buzz, engage with their target audience, and drive registration. Social media also provides opportunities for attendee engagement before, during, and after the event, fostering ongoing connections and conversation.

Measuring the Success of Your B2B Event Marketing

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) for B2B Event Marketing

Measuring the success of your B2B event marketing efforts is crucial to evaluate ROI and make informed decisions for future events. Key performance indicators (KPIs) such as attendance rate, lead generation, attendee satisfaction, social media engagement, and revenue generated can provide valuable insights into the effectiveness and impact of your events.

Post-Event Analysis and Feedback

Conducting a thorough post-event analysis and gathering attendee feedback is vital for continuous improvement. By analyzing data, feedback, and insights gathered during and after the event, you can identify areas of strength and areas for improvement. This information can then be used to refine your event marketing strategy, enhance future events, and deliver more value to your target audience.
